Output 668575d45b07282c63dee7282a2b35bb5fcdd4bad80722977e9bf469ea95b996:0

value
1170000
script pubkey
OP_0 OP_PUSHBYTES_20 8b7684ffd7a76a4c3a66bae2bb4c51a5b8e93072
address
bc1q3dmgfl7h5a4ycwnxht3tknz35kuwjvrj2cqpua
transaction
668575d45b07282c63dee7282a2b35bb5fcdd4bad80722977e9bf469ea95b996